- Asian shares were mostly higher after Nvidia and other technology stocks led an advance on Wall Street.
- The regional move was uneven: Japan’s Nikkei 225 rose 0.8%, Hong Kong’s Hang Seng gained 0.3%, Taiwan’s Taiex climbed 1%, and South Korea’s Kospi fell 1%.
- Markets were awaiting a speech by Federal Reserve Chair Kevin Warsh for signals on U.S. monetary policy.
